What more I could love in BiaB 2010: ( maybe a little odd wishes, please, dont think of me as a obsessed audio nerd )

- Send and receive of MIDI time code/clock or SMPTE sync commands in order get BiaB synchronized with daws like Cubase, Nuendo, Sonar, Protools, etc. Example: sometimes I play and send BiaB midi data on fly to Cubase in my laptop, or in the same PC via a virtual midi cable loopback (Midiyoke or similar), then set and match Cubase midi tracks with BiaB instruments midi channels and assign differents VSTi to each one in Cubase, great! until you figure out that BiaB can´t be synchronized to external midi/audio sequencers, therefore there is not possible time sync play/record. Of course I export MIDI files from BiaB to my daws for post-production, but there is a lot of fun implied when BiaB is used like a master sequencer.

- Multiple audio port driver (ASIO) or independent dx/vst plugins routing . Currently only one stereo audio outs can be selected in BiaB, despite the audio card is multiple outs featured, for example , my M-Audio Delta 1010 card . This advanced feature Itself could let to send RDs, RTs and BiaB audio track to different outs each. Example: sometimes I record my guitar as a dry not processed signal in BiaB audio track in order, to later on, to apply my favorite guitar amp simulator VST plugin, but then RDs audio is also processed for the guitar plugin because both, audio track and RDs use the same audio route. An APR, After Plugin Routing button (similar to audio mixers AFL) for each audio source, at a point in the BiaB signal path after the Dx/VST plugin could work great.
- Multiple undos
- A fix for simultaneous audio and midi recording bug, (midi is not recorded while audio does perfectly) although I hope it be fixed in next 2009 revs.

1) The ability to send MIDI change information to external devices, while using the VST/DXi Synth feature (re: the following support email from BB)
You must keep in mind that this setup will not produce any sound, since all the MIDI is sent to the vocal harmonizer. Band-in-a-Box can send MIDI to only one port, so alternatively, you might want to use RealBand.Thank-You,Blake PG Music Inc.
2) Focus on features designed for the live GiGs.
- Easy set-up of playlists (without changing the names of the songs to get them to play in a certain order)
- A live gig style jukebox where I can set the amount of time between song playback, or better yet control it by a foot control.
- Programmable PC keyboard keys for things like volume up/down
(currently that feature requires two hands on my PC)
3) When creating a new song using Real Tracks, it takes alot of time to keep rebuilding the song (during the process of reviewing the song over and over), so if there was a way to do a partial build so only a bass or piano part is only being generated each time... then have the option to do a full generation.

I’d like to see the “Record Melody / Record From” window have an optional button or switch somewhere in the window which would give the window the ability to remember the last “Record From Bar #” entered.

As it is now, the user is forced to manually enter the original "From Bar #", upon stopping every unsuccessful take.

Upon stopping an unsuccessful take, with the proposed optional “Remember From Bar #” button activated, the program would automatically whisk itself back to whatever bar number was last entered and then be ready to record the next take. (The last bar # that was entered would auto-retained or automatically re-entered or pasted and the program would thereby be ready to record the next take.)

Not only would this option be a great convenience to have during the recording of multiple takes, it would significicantly speed up the process of recording where multiple takes are necessary to achieve that sucessful take.

Quote:

1. Key changes. A real key change so that the I,IV,V display is updated.

2. User defined chords. Don't worry if the auto-generation scheme stops working for now. We don't just use BIAB to autogenerate parts.




The Roman Numerals should not change when the key sig is changed.

The I in the key of C is still I in the Key of F (or any other key) even though they have two different letter names.

I think you are after "Fixed Do" numerics, though.
